Abstract: his study evaluates the ecological status of Béni Haroun Dam (Mila Province), the largest water reservoir in Algeria with a storage capacity of 2.5 billion m³. The research aimed to assess water quality through the combined analysis of physicochemical parameters and phytoplankton communities. Sampling was conducted at 5 stations across the reservoir. Water temperatures ranged from 28°C to 29°C (mean 28.4°C), the pH was alkaline (mean 8.88), and average turbidity measured 24.6 NTU. A total of 13 phytoplankton genera were identified, spanning 5 phyla and 8 classes. The dominant taxa were Oocystis (38.67%), Spirogyra (25.33%), and Ceratium (13.33%), with Spirogyra occurring in 80% of the stations. The Shannon diversity index ranged from 0.56 to 1.55 bits, with the highest value recorded at station S1. Maximum cell abundance reached 33 individuals at station S2. Principal Component Analysis (PCA) revealed strong correlations between environmental parameters (nutrients, temperature, turbidity) and phytoplankton distribution. The findings highlight the influence of anthropogenic pressures (e.g., agricultural runoff, wastewater) on the reservoir's trophic state. The study recommends implementing an integrated and sustainable management strategy to prevent eutrophication and preserve essential ecosystem services.
